Site assessment
We inspect access, drainage, levels and the condition of the existing driveway.
Preparation
The area is excavated and a substantial compacted base is installed.
Edging
Borders and retaining edges are set accurately before surfacing.
Surfacing
Tarmac is laid, rolled and finished cleanly around entrances and drainage.

Is tarmac suitable for a large residential driveway?
Yes. Tarmac is a practical, hard-wearing option for larger entrances and busy family driveways when the ground preparation, edges, levels and drainage are planned correctly.
Can a tarmac driveway have block paved edging?
Yes. Contrasting block paving or kerb edging can define the entrance, strengthen the perimeter and tie the driveway into the style of the property.
